Overview
- Detroit built a 3-0 lead in the sixth on a Gleyber Torres solo homer and a two-run double by Wenceel Pérez.
- With the bases loaded after two strikeouts in the seventh, Shea Langeliers launched his second career grand slam for a 6-3 Oakland lead.
- Skubal worked 6 2/3 innings and allowed six runs with only one earned, striking out 12 with no walks for his 10th double-digit strikeout game.
- Zach McKinstry’s error at shortstop extended the inning, all five runs were unearned, and the slam was the first Skubal has allowed in his career.
- Colby Thomas began the rally with a solo homer and rookie Nick Kurtz added a two-run pinch-hit shot in the eighth; next up is Charlie Morton vs. Osvaldo Bido, with Oakland riding six straight wins against left-handed starters.
